Ed Barrett


User Stats

Profile Images

User Bio

Ed Barrett is half of animade.tv. In the past he's worked all over London as a freelancer, but now mostly sits overlooking the Electricity Showrooms on Old Street.

External Links


  1. Animade
  2. Jack Haslehurst
  3. Escape Studios
  4. Moth
  5. Senén
  6. Kristian Andrews
  7. Tom Judd
  8. Mikey Please
  9. Brent Lilley
  10. Ryan Edquist
  11. Kristian Andrews